nHydrate.Generator.Common.GeneratorFramework.GeneratorHelper.GenerateProjectItems C# (CSharp) Method

GenerateProjectItems() private method

private GenerateProjectItems ( IProjectItemGenerator projectItemGenerator ) : void
projectItemGenerator IProjectItemGenerator
return void
        private void GenerateProjectItems(IProjectItemGenerator projectItemGenerator)
        {
            try
            {
                projectItemGenerator.GenerationComplete += new ProjectItemGenerationCompleteEventHandler(projectItemGenerator_GenerationComplete);
                projectItemGenerator.ProjectItemGenerated += new ProjectItemGeneratedEventHandler(projectItemGenerator_ProjectItemGenerated);
                projectItemGenerator.ProjectItemDeleted += new ProjectItemDeletedEventHandler(projectItemGenerator_ProjectItemDeleted);
                projectItemGenerator.ProjectItemExists += new ProjectItemExistsEventHandler(projectItemGenerator_ProjectItemExists);
                projectItemGenerator.ProjectItemGenerationError += new ProjectItemGeneratedErrorEventHandler(projectItemGenerator_ProjectItemGenerationError);
                projectItemGenerator.Generate();
            }
            catch (Exception ex)
            {
                _errorList.Add(ex.ToString());
                nHydrateLog.LogError(ex);
                throw;
            }
        }

Same methods

GeneratorHelper::GenerateProjectItems ( IProjectGenerator projectGenerator ) : void
GeneratorHelper::GenerateProjectItems ( Type projectItemGeneratorType ) : void